How Emergency Water Extraction Works
Our team’s process is designed to be efficient, thorough, and minimally invasive. We understand that water damage can be overwhelming, so we’ll guide you through every step of the way, from initial assessment to final cleanup.
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ify any potential health hazards, ensuring your safety and well-being.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your property, pre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your space, including indust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ers, ensuring your property is completely dry and free of mo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property, removing any remaining debris, dirt, and bacteria.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is completely restored to its pre-damage condition, guaranteeing your satisfaction and peace of mind.

Warning Signs You Need Emergency Water Extraction
Water damage can sneak up on you, but there are warning signs to watch out for.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Our team is here to help you identify and address these warning signs, before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, compromising its structural integrity and potentially leading to costly repairs. If you notice any signs of water damage to your flooring, don’t wait, call us.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of hidden water damage, which can spread and cause extensive damage if left unchecked. If you notice any water stains or discoloration, it’s time to call our team.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ause peeling paint or wallpaper, revealing hidden moisture and potential mold growth. If you notice any signs of peeling paint or wallpaper, don’t wait, call us.
Water Damage to Electrical Outlets or Appliances
Water damage can cause electrical outlets or appliances to malfunction or fail, potentially leading to electrical shock or fire hazards. If you notice any signs of water damage to your electrical systems, call our team immediately.
Visible Water Damage or Flooding
Visible water damage or flooding can be a sign of a serious issue, needing immediate attention to prevent further damage and potential health hazards. If you notice any signs of water damage or flooding, don’t wait, call us.
Emergency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small water leaks. |
| Large water leak (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large water leaks need professional equipment and expertise to mitigate damage. |
|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address. |
| Standing water (over 1 inch deep) | No | Yes | Stand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further damage. |
| Mold growth or suspected m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th. |
| Electrical or gas-related water damage | No | Yes | Electrical or gas-related water damage needs professional expertise to safely address and prevent electrical shock or fire hazards. |

Emergency Water Extraction Cost In Barnesville, GA
Prices for emergency water extraction services v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Barnesville, GA. These are estimates, not guarantees, and the actual cost may be higher or lower based on your specific situation. We’ll provide a free, no-obligation est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, local conditions |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ment required, labor costs |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, electrical repairs)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of equipment required, labor costs |
